Heat in Sheridan County

Across a year, Sheridan County accumulates about 1,706 growing degree days above 50°F, about 36 more than the middle Montana county — ahead of 28 of Montana’s 56 counties. Degree days are the heat a crop actually gets to work with — more of them is more room to ripen a long-season crop before the freeze closes the window.

Soil in Sheridan County

Across Sheridan County, the ground is predominantly Mollisols, where Williams, Zahill, and Vida are the most extensive named soil series. The soil is generally well drained with a loam surface. Topsoil pH runs about 7.0–7.9, slightly alkaline. Rainfall drains through hydrologic group C soils.

What this means for growing in Sheridan County

Each reading below is measured for Sheridan County itself — here is what it means for a garden here, and the move an experienced grower makes about it.

Drainage

Measured

The dominant soils across Sheridan County are well drained, in hydrologic group C — ground that drains quickly.

The upside is soil you can work early in spring and roots that never drown; the cost is that fast-draining ground dries out fast and leaches nutrients away before plants can use them.

Work in compost and mulch to hold moisture and feed, and water more often in short doses than deep and rarely.

USDA NRCS SSURGO

Surface pH

Measured

Topsoil across Sheridan County runs about pH 7.0–7.9, on the alkaline side.

Many vegetables cope, but acid-lovers like blueberries struggle, and iron and manganese lock up above about pH 7.5 — leaves yellow between the veins even in rich soil.

Elemental sulfur and generous organic matter lower pH slowly for the beds that need it; test first so you add only what the soil actually calls for.

USDA NRCS SSURGO

Season length

Measured

Sheridan County runs about 144 days between hard freezes — a short growing season.

Long-maturing crops like melons, sweet potatoes, and winter squash can run out of runway before the first hard freeze, ripening late or not at all.

Lead with fast-maturing varieties, and stretch the season on both ends with cold frames, low tunnels, or a greenhouse.

NOAA 1991–2020 Climate Normals

Winter hardiness

Measured

Sheridan County sits in USDA hardiness zone 3b.

The zone sets which perennials, shrubs, and fruit trees live through an average winter here — a plant rated for a colder zone is a safe bet, one rated warmer needs winter protection or gets treated as an annual.

Match perennials and fruit to the zone before you buy, so nothing you plant is a gamble against the cold.

Is it too late to plant in Sheridan County?

For most of the year, no — what changes is which crops still fit the days remaining. Cool-season crops can go in from around Apr 9; tender transplants wait until two to three weeks after the last 28°F hard freeze, which lands near May 7 (NOAA 1991–2020 climate normals); and from midsummer, planting counts back from the first fall freeze around Sep 28 — long-season crops need about 90 days of runway, quick greens only 30. In a season this compact, fast finishers and cold-hardy greens do the late work, and garlic tucked in before the freeze repays you next summer.

What gets applied to farmland in Sheridan County

USGS estimates 432,971 lb of Glyphosate on Sheridan County farmland in 2019, its largest by weight, ahead of 2,4-d (101,238 lb) and Bromoxynil (52,153 lb).

Common questions about Sheridan County

When does frost risk typically end in Sheridan County?

The last hard freeze (28°F) in Sheridan County typically lands around May 7, per NOAA 1991–2020 climate normals — earlier than the light-frost dates most charts quote. That marks the hard freeze, not the last light frost — lighter frosts keep biting past it, which is why tender transplants here wait until about May 28.

How long is the growing season in Sheridan County?

Measured between 28°F hard freezes, Sheridan County sees about 144 frost-free days — roughly May 7 through Sep 28, per NOAA 1991–2020 climate normals. Tender crops work a shorter one: nearer May 28 to Sep 14, about 109 days.

Is the soil safe to grow vegetables in Sheridan County?

The federal record around Sheridan County is a meaningful one — 288 documented sites, mostly Nitrate entries (194), the nearest Nitrate record about 2.7 miles out — so a soil test before new food beds is a sensible precaution here, not a reason to hold back from growing. Remember that proximity to a documented site is information, not a diagnosis of any one yard; the contamination map shows exactly what sits where.

How do gardeners stretch the season in Sheridan County?

With about 144 frost-free days between hard freezes, Sheridan County rewards the classic extension moves: floating row cover buys roughly two to four extra weeks at each shoulder — on this season that is a working window nearer 172 to 200 days — and cold frames or low tunnels buy more. Starting transplants indoors ahead of the May 7 hard-freeze normal stretches the season without touching the calendar.
